Wildflower Health, a tech-enabled women’s health company backed by Truehelm, has acquired Every Mother, a digital pelvic floor and core health program. The acquisition aims to improve maternal care by making specialized core and pelvic health a standard, accessible resource.

Founded in 2018, Every Mother serves women through pregnancy, postpartum recovery, and beyond. "Mothers shouldn’t have to act as their own care coordinators during one of the most physically demanding chapters of their lives," stated Leah Sparks, CEO and Founder of Wildflower Health. She emphasized that prenatal prep and postpartum recovery have often been overlooked, and this acquisition will elevate the quality of maternal care and enhance long-term outcomes.

Wildflower Health, based in San Francisco, and Every Mother, headquartered in New York City, will combine their expertise to address critical needs in women's health.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ed. Allison Rapaport is the CEO and founder of Every Mother.
